There is a great mix of class sizes at CWE. Our daughter is in 3rd grade gifted and there are 32 students in the class. Our youngest is in 'kinder' and there are less than 20 in class. Obviously we can not speak for the entire school, but the class size does not seem to affect them. The attention paid by the teachers and level of learning thus far is excellent. Being it a bi-lingual school (first in the nation), the child has a double challenge, but it is brought in a very well balanced package, which is very well managed by the staff and teachers. Overall I am somewhat discourage with the bilingual program. I feel it's taking time from our children to learn more grammar and math in english than in spanish. 60% english it is not suffient time. They should have it at least 80%. Although I am bilingual myself, I see that my son is having difficulties w/both languages at the same time.

I, have two kids in this school..and only have very high things about this Institution. Most of the teachers are bi-lingual and teach in English and Spanish, in every school room are both teachers, which I, think is great. There is also a gifted program that have three bi-lingual teachers. I, saw kids learn Spanish and English with great facility. My kids both read and write English and Spanish. There is also a pilot program to learn Spanish after school hours 'International study Program' and at end of program 5Th grade the Spain Education Goverment, send an invitation to students to go to Spain schools for 2 weeks.
